During the dosing session, the therapist and participant agree on boundary rules. During the session, the participant should remain fully clothed. In addition, the participant must follow the safety guidelines provided by the therapist. For the duration of the therapy, the therapist and sitter must remain in the room with the participant. They must also be present during brief breaks for the restroom. These guidelines help the therapist and participants work together to create a safe space for the psychedelic experience.
 
Psilocybin is a psychoactive substance found naturally in mushrooms. People who consume them may experience profound changes in perception, emotion, thought processes, and time. They may also experience strong hallucinations or visual images. Although psilocybin is a powerful psychoactive drug, its effects on the body are limited and unlikely to be permanent.
